SQLinfo.ru - Все о MySQL

Форум пользователей MySQL

Задавайте вопросы, мы ответим

Вы не зашли.

#1 29.02.2008 11:58:01

Aerarh
Участник
Зарегистрирован: 16.02.2008
Сообщений: 12

Как выключить "Notice: Undefined variable:..."

Как выключить эту "полезную" ерунду? (выводится на браузер) спасибо

Неактивен

 

#2 29.02.2008 12:13:41

rgbeast
Администратор
MySQL Authorized Developer and DBA
Откуда: Москва
Зарегистрирован: 21.01.2007
Сообщений: 3878

Re: Как выключить "Notice: Undefined variable:..."

в PHP
error_reporting(E_ALL ^ E_NOTICE);

Неактивен

 

#3 20.03.2008 12:49:45

Neval
Гуру
Откуда: Киев
Зарегистрирован: 11.03.2008
Сообщений: 449

Re: Как выключить "Notice: Undefined variable:..."

А почему бы не определять все переменные перед использованием? По-моему так будет надёжнее, чем просто отключить вывод ошибок.
Приведу пример:
Этот код отработает без проблем:

Код:

$variable = 0;
$variable++;

А этот код выдаст ошибку Undefined variable: $varaible, что поможет легко понять в чём проблема.

Код:

$variable = 0;
$varaible++;

Подобные опечатки найти не так уж и легко, на самом-то деле.


Человек без чувства юмора - не серьёзный человек wink

Неактивен

 

Board footer

Работает на PunBB
© Copyright 2002–2008 Rickard Andersson